The largest prank I ever pulled was with the help of a friend while in the Cayman Islands.
We had an ongoing practical joke going with a person from a company in the same plaza we were in. It's a very long story so I will cut to the chase.
We created a company called Uncle Rod's pony rides. (Rod was the receiving end of out practical jokes) We had flyers and business cards printed, we took out 20 radio ads and a quarter page newspaper ad all announcing the grand opening. The ads were very cheesy with many not so hidden jabs. One line from the newspaper ad was "Children under 12 get to ride Uncle Rod's pony for free". There were others. The grand opening took place in front of Rod's office.

It is a much better practical joke if you were to know all of the people involved and all of the circumstances leading up to it.

The only thing that sort of backfired on us was that on all of the print advertising we did we listed the phone number as 555-1234. Fake number right? Nobody uses the 555 exchange right? Wrong. It turned out to be the direct line to the Cayman General Hospital's emergency room.
